HARD KNOCKS: TRAINING CAMP WITH THE CINCINNATI BENGALS
AUG. 19 EPISODE
HBO Sports, in association with NFL Films and the Cincinnati Bengals, provides an all-access look at what it takes to make it in the National Football League in HARD KNOCKS: TRAINING CAMP WITH THE CINCINNATI BENGALS. The first sports-based reality series – and one of the fastest-turnaround reality series – continues its five-episode season WEDNESDAY, AUG. 19 (10:00-11:00 p.m. ET/PT), exclusively on HBO. Subsequent hour-long editions air each Wednesday at the same time, culminating in the Sept. 9 season finale.
Each week, players experience drills, meetings and fun, while struggling to prove they have what it takes to make the team and make their mark in the NFL.

Coaches make player evaluations as the Bengals play their first preseason game against the New Orleans Saints. The relationship between quarterback Carson Palmer and his brother, Bengals back-up quarterback Jordan Palmer, comes under focus.
A 24-person NFL Films crew is living at the Bengals training camp, shooting more than 1000 hours of video over the course of the series. Camera and sound crews are given unencumbered access to the players’ and coaches’ meeting rooms, training rooms, dormitories and practice fields. The Bengals are currently training in Georgetown, Ky., and will return to Cincinnati in late August.
